HILARY MANTEL is the author of fourteen books, including A Place of Greater Safety, Beyond Black, the memoir Giving Up the Ghost and the short-story collection The Assassination of Margaret Thatcher. Her two most recent novels, Wolf Hall and its sequel, Bring Up the Bodies, have both been awarded the Man Booker Prize-an unprecedented achievement.
